Subject: Divestiture of the Coastal Logistics Unit

Team,

As our incoming director joins this week, here is where we stand on the sale of the Coastal Logistics unit to Marrowfield Holdings. Diligence closed Friday, and the purchase agreement is in final review with counsel. Staff transfers are mapped, and the Verano City warehouse lease conveys with the deal. Expected close is end of next quarter. Please route questions through the transaction office rather than the unit itself. The strategic rationale is summarized below.

board note of bagaf-haduf: The renewal with Druathek Holdings closes at $10 million a year, 5 percent below the last contract. Project Zorath slips by six weeks because of the staffing delay.

## Authentication

Heads up: the nightly reindex job (`reindex_nightly.py`) talks to the Lanternfish search cluster, and that cluster won't accept anonymous writes anymore — we locked it down last sprint. The job now authenticates as the `reindex-runner` service identity against Corvid Gateway, and the token is injected via the `LF_INDEX_TOKEN` env var in the scheduler config. Nothing clever going on, just a bearer header on every batch request. For review purposes, the staging credential currently in use is listed below.

service key, kadug-kadup: kto15_rN23XLAYImmZgrJ

Re: Retirement of the Stonebriar product line

Stonebriar sales have declined for five consecutive quarters and support costs now exceed contribution margin. The retirement plan is staged: new orders close end of Q2, existing contracts honoured through their terms, and spares stocked for twenty-four months. Sales leads should steer prospects toward the Ashgrove range; migration incentives are already approved. Customer comms are drafted and awaiting legal sign-off. The forward strategy behind this decision is set out in the note below.

confidential, yafog-hagug: Gross margin on Druix came in at 10 percent against a plan of 15 percent. Only 5 of the 80 pilot accounts renewed Druix, so a churn review is set for October 1.